Deuteronomy 15:16

Webster's Bible (1833)

It shall be, if he tell you, I will not go out from you; because he loves you and your house, because he is well with you;

  • Exod 21:2-7
    6 verses
    82%

    2 If you buy a Hebrew servant, he shall serve six years and in the seventh he shall go out free without paying anything.

    3 If he comes in by himself, he shall go out by himself. If he is married, then his wife shall go out with him.

    4 If his master gives him a wife and she bears him sons or daughters, the wife and her children shall be her master's, and he shall go out by himself.

    5 But if the servant shall plainly say, 'I love my master, my wife, and my children. I will not go out free;'

    6 then his master shall bring him to God, and shall bring him to the door or to the door-post, and his master shall bore his ear through with an awl, and he shall serve him for ever.

    7 "If a man sells his daughter to be a maid-servant, she shall not go out as the men-servants do.
